The effects of tetrodotoxin, have been tested experimentally
on a large variety of animal species such as crap, rat, Frog,
Rabbit, Dog and Cat (These effects involve primarily the
peripheral neuromuscular system, which is paralyzed to
different extents because of interference with generation and
conduction of electrical impulses (Russell and Dart, 1991).
Tetrodotoxin is a highly potent emetic agent (Atwell and
Stutchbury, 1978; Mohamed, 2003). Therefore the objective
